Adding a sitemap to Google's Webmaster tools is one of the first tips you will be told to do when you first manage a web site or blog. It is an easy process to do, and you can get many benefits from it, such as monitoring how Google is indexing your pages, the external and internal links it finds, and any problems Google may find with indexing your site Read More »

Ok something a bit more technical this afternoon. Not so much for beginners but for those with some web design experience.
Today I've been involved in a debate on an SEO forum about how important having valid HTML markup on your website is. I had previously read in a posting by Google themselves that they don't give priority to pages that validate, in fact, they said they don't even check that. If you search for anything on Google and try and validate the top pages, unless you're searching for webdesign or something similar (most web designers today are very anal about having valid code) most if not all of the top pages won't validate using the W3 HTML Validation tool. We've moved up another page for the term architects. It's going to be fairly slow going from here on in, but I'm expecting another jump soon - I've been going through and changing our anchor text in the signatures of various forum accounts that I post to and looking at the 'what googlebot sees' feature in Google's webmaster tools the term 'architects' has shot up to number 4 on our list, and 'international architects' (our previous target) has moved down to number 7. This should start affecting the SERPs any day now. Google seems to be quite slow nowadays. I made some text changes on the site about 2 weeks ago and it's yet to show up in the SERPs.
